I'm bringing up a new tuning laptop (an old IBM X31 but now with Win 7, 32bit), my old links for downloading and installing EasyTherm appear to be broken (as is the link on the DIYAutotune download page). Is there a current link for downloading the latest EasyTherm? (and will it run on Win 7)
And while I am at it, these are the numbers I have been using for my stock CLT sensor (for a 91 Miata, MSPNP9093), I see other numbers posted in various threads, is there a definitive value?
I use:
(temp in F)
-4 16000
68 2450
140 580

For the thermistor values, I have been using the rx7 defaults in EasyTherm which are
*C............Resistance(Ohms)
-20..........16200
20............2450
80.............320
I think that's right.

Interesting, this version of Easytherm 5.0 installed fine, ran like it always did and the log says it wrote the .inc and s19 files but it does not. No errors but the files do not show in the project directory like they always did. Not sure why but it does not seem to be able to write the files in windows 7 (32bit).
If anyone else has this version (Easytherm 5.0) working properly on Win 7, let me know. Otherwise I will go find an XP machine and run everything from there.

Figured out what was going on with Easytherm and Win 7. The files were being written to some virtual directory that was not visible to me in the normal directory. So ET thought everything was fine but Win 7 was isolating the output to keep me 'safe'.
Found them by viewing compatible files, fixed it by giving ET administrative rights (which it did not have for some reason, even though I installed it as an Admin).
